Cradle Mountain Huts - a trip worth recommending

From my personal perspective the trip exceeded expectations.

 

The weather was better than I anticipated despite knowing what I should expect. Scenery to use an old cliché was God’s country. The logistics of the trip in terms of organisation, pickup, transport and drop off, debrief, walking and guides involved all ran without fault. The guides were excellent both in accommodating & supporting clientele. There was no pressure in meeting deadlines. The huts and accommodation delivered in spades, and meals satisfied in full. It is a trip worth recommending to anyone interested in visiting the area.
